There are no professional anti-counterfeiters, and some businesses are too much. It was labeled as 500 grams of pistachios, but the desiccant accounted for 191.2 grams and the box was 72 grams. Consumers found out that they had been deceived, but they were rebuffed by the merchants and told not to be too ignorant!

Some netizens even sent their hearts to explain to the merchants, saying that the package was marked with a weight of 500 grams, but did not say that the net weight was 500 grams. You can not understand this kind of remarks, but please don't talk nonsense.

In a similar case, the pistachios purchased by Ms. Chen were legally pre-packaged food. Whenever buying this kind of food with packaging, consumers must remember that there are basically national food safety standards. If it does not meet the relevant standards, it will either constitute fraudulent sales, and one will be refunded and three will be compensated. Either it belongs to the sale of food that does not meet food safety standards, and one will be refunded and ten will be paid.

For pre-packaged food, in addition to complying with the national safety standards of the corresponding food category, it is also necessary to comply with the general rules of pre-packaged food labeling.

The General Principles of Prepackaged Food Labelling clearly stipulate that prepackaged food must be labeled with a net content, and the net content shall consist of a net content, a number and a legal unit of measurement.

Liquid food is indicated in volume, liters or milliliters. Solid food is indicated by mass, kilogram or gram. The use of kilograms as a unit is an illegal violation of food safety standards.

Taking the pistachio purchased by Ms. Chen in this case as an example, according to the general rules for the labeling of prepackaged food, it should be marked with "net content: 236.8g".

Not only that, the state also clearly requires that the net content should be displayed on the same page as the name of the food, so that consumers can easily see the label of the net content when they see the name of the food.

Therefore, in this case, Ms. Chen should directly call 12345 where the merchant's store is registered, complain to the local market supervision and administration bureau, and ask the market supervision and administration bureau to impose a penalty and inform the punishment result.

After Ms. Chen got the penalty result, if the merchant did not take the initiative to refund one and compensate three, and directly sued the court, the penalty result of the Market Supervision and Administration Bureau would be the best evidence to win the lawsuit.

Another key point is that, according to the judicial interpretation of the Supreme People's Court, consumers who shop online can sue in the court of the place where the goods are received, so as to avoid the pain of travel.
